    Quoted from Rat_Tomago:

    Next I will be actively searching in this order for
    Kings and Queens
    Buckaroo
    Crosstown
    North Star
    Central Park

    Great choices!

    Of those titles North Star seems hardest to find at the moment so if you find one, don't let it go.

    Buckaroo is insanely addictive - line up those 7 numbers - pop, pop, pop, pop!

    And I have been looking for a souper douper mint Crosstown for ages and ages - plenty around but not in the condition I want.

    Central Park seems easiest to pick up for some reason.
